Brief summary
Children with congenital heart diseases (CHD) often show reduced health related physical fitness as well as limitations in gross and fine motor skills/development. Intervention programs in childhood are still rare and often focus just on the improvement of cardiac outcomes or exercise capacity. Web-based interventions, as a useful alternative to training manuals or supervised training, are cost effective and allow a customization of training times. Primary purpose of this study is to improve health related physical fitness in children with congenital heart disease.
Interventions
* The intervention group gets access to a training platform. Every week, 3 training videos of 20 minutes each will be released on that platform with the aim to perform those during the ongoing week. * Each exercise session is arranged in a video session with child friendly instructions and executions for the different exercises. The videos serve as a virtual training partner and exercise will be performed simultaneously while watching the video * The overall training volume is 72 session calculated from 3 sessions per week over a duration of 24 weeks (6 month)

Eligibility
Inclusion criteria
* Ages 10-18 years old. * CHD with moderate to complex severity according to the ACC criteria. * Health-related physical fitness \<50th percentile (healthy reference). * German speaking. * internet availability and an internet-capable device to use the intervention app * Informed consent of parent/guardian as well as of the child.
Exclusion criteria
* Severe Arrhythmias * Severe Left Heart Failure * Chromosomal anomalies and/or genetic syndromes. * Severe physical and/or sensory impairments (hearing, visual, or psychomotor). * Elective cardiac intervention within the next 6 months following enrollment.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Improvement of health related physical fitness | at 24 weeks | The FitnessGram® is a fitness test from the Cooper Institute that assesses health-related physical fitness. It uses evidence-based standards to measure functional health status of the musculoskeletal system divided into the components muscular strength, muscular endurance and flexibility. The FitnessGram® includes tests for the upper body and the abdominal/trunk areas. Mean scores were calculated and compared to an actual reference sample of German children and adolescents. |
